Improving and Protecting Water, Air and Soil Quality
California’s dairy farmers are currently pursuing multi-benefit projects to increase water quality and reduce greenhouse gas emissions. By utilizing cutting-edge on farm management practices, our members are already helping achieve some of the highest water quality standards, which is especially important in disadvantaged communities who are most impacted by contaminated supplies yet lack the resources to adequately respond.
Through innovative and feasible healthy soil management practices, including regenerative soil production via compost, the industry is helping promote a circular agricultural economy in California.

DWR LandFlex Program
In partnership with the Department of Water Resources (DWR), California’s dairy industry has implemented the groundbreaking LandFlex Program, which includes temporarily fallowing fields for one year and permanently eliminating overdraft groundwater pumping on specified lands, including dairies, leaving more groundwater available for drinking water wells.
